Tangent Lines to Level Curves

In Exercises 25–28, sketch the curve \(f(x,y)=c\) together with \(\nabla f\) and the tangent line at the given point. Then write an equation for the tangent line.

               \(x^{2}+y^{2}=4,(\sqrt{2}, \sqrt{2})\)
